Introdução

Bem-vindo ao nosso guia completo sobre como lidar com entradas de sistema de arquivos e ZIP usando o Aspose.TeX para .NET — uma biblioteca robusta projetada para manipulação perfeita de documentos TeX e LaTeX. Este tutorial guiará você pelo processo passo a passo, garantindo que você possa converter documentos LaTeX para diversos formatos com eficiência.

Pré-requisitos

Antes de começar, certifique-se de ter o seguinte pronto:

  • Biblioteca Aspose.TeX para .NET: Baixe e instale a biblioteca do Página de download do Aspose.TeX para .NET.

  • Conhecimento básico de TeX/LaTeX: A familiaridade com os conceitos de TeX ou LaTeX ajudará você a entender melhor os processos envolvidos.

  • Ambiente de desenvolvimento .NET: tenha seu ambiente de desenvolvimento .NET configurado em sua máquina.

  • Arquivos de entrada: prepare seu documento TeX junto com todos os pacotes necessários para sua conversão.

Agora, vamos começar com o guia passo a passo.

Etapa 1: Importar os namespaces necessários

Para acessar as funcionalidades fornecidas pelo Aspose.TeX, inclua os seguintes namespaces no seu projeto .NET:

using Aspose.TeX.IO;
using Aspose.TeX.Presentation.Image;
using System.IO;

Etapa 2: Criar opções de conversão

Configure suas opções de conversão para o formato Object LaTeX, especificando um diretório de trabalho para a saída:

TeXOptions options = TeXOptions.ConsoleAppOptions(TeXConfig.ObjectLaTeX);
options.OutputWorkingDirectory = new OutputFileSystemDirectory("Your Output Directory");

Etapa 3: especifique o diretório de entrada

Defina o diretório que contém os arquivos de entrada necessários, incluindo todos os pacotes necessários:

options.RequiredInputDirectory = new InputFileSystemDirectory(Path.Combine("Your Input Directory", "packages"));

Etapa 4: Inicializar opções de salvamento

Em seguida, prepare suas opções de salvamento para gerar o documento no formato PNG:

options.SaveOptions = new PngSaveOptions();

Etapa 5: Execute a conversão de LaTeX para PNG

Use o TeXJob classe para realizar a conversão do seu documento LaTeX para PNG:

new TeXJob(Path.Combine("Your Input Directory", "required-input-fs.tex"), new ImageDevice(), options).Run();

Conclusão

Parabéns! Você aprendeu com sucesso a lidar com entradas de sistema de arquivos e ZIP no Aspose.TeX para .NET. Este tutorial abordou tudo, desde a importação de namespaces até a execução do processo de conversão, destacando como o Aspose.TeX simplifica o gerenciamento e a conversão de documentos.

Perguntas frequentes

O Aspose.TeX pode manipular outros formatos de documento?

O Aspose.TeX se concentra principalmente no processamento de documentos TeX e LaTeX. Se precisar trabalhar com outros formatos, considere explorar outros produtos Aspose desenvolvidos especialmente para essas necessidades.

Onde posso encontrar documentação adicional para o Aspose.TeX?

A documentação completa está disponível em Documentação do Aspose.TeX para .NET.

O que devo fazer se tiver problemas?

Para obter suporte, visite o Fórum Aspose.TeX para assistência comunitária, ou considere uma licença temporária para ajuda prioritária.

Existe uma opção de teste gratuito disponível?

Sim, você pode acessar uma versão de teste gratuita em Lançamentos do Aspose.TeX.

Como posso comprar o Aspose.TeX para .NET?

Você pode comprar Aspose.TeX para .NET diretamente do página de compra.